Contents:
Introduction: pain and prosperity in twentieth-century Germany / Greg Eghigian and Paul Betts -- Pain, entitlement, and social citzenship in modern Germany / Greg Eghigian -- Cities forget, nations remember: Berlin and Germany and the shock of modernity / Peter Fritzsche -- Purchasing comfort: patent remedieis and the alleviation of labor pain in Germany between 1914 and 1933 / Patricia R. Stokes -- Modern pain and Nazi panic / Geoffrey Cocks -- The transformation of sacrifice: German identity between heroic narrative and economic sucess / Sabine Behrenbeck -- The myth of a suspended present: prosperity's painful shadow in 1950s East Germany / Katherine Pence -- Scarcity and success: the East according to the West during the 1950s / Ingrid M. Schenk -- Remembrance of things past: nostalgia in West and East Germany, 1980s-2000 / Paul Betts.
